The village forge in Haunsheim , a municipality in the district of Dillingen an der Donau in the Bavarian administrative district of Swabia , was built in 1605. The former smithy near the church square is a protected architectural monument .

description

The half-timbered house made of stone masonry and with a half-timbered upper floor was built in 1605 and renovated in the second half of the 17th century. In the 19th century, the building, which is covered by a tent roof, was changed again.

The nasal label says: Huf- u. Wagenschmiede Wilh. Renfftlen .
